# Dual-run flags (RMGR-WP-0002)
|
||||
|
||||
State Hub remains the MCP/REST entrypoint. When flags are on, **checkout
|
||||
mutation** is executed by Repo Manager.
|
||||
|
||||
## Environment variables
|
||||
|
||||
| Variable | Meaning |
|
||||
| --- | --- |
|
||||
| `RM_WRITEBACK=1` | Task file writeback via `rmgr update-task-status` |
|
||||
| `RM_RECONCILE=1` | `fix-consistency` also runs `rmgr reconcile` for pilots |
|
||||
| `RM_PILOT_REPOS=repo-manager` | Comma-separated slugs; **unset** = all repos when flags on |
|
||||
| `RM_METER_PATH` | JSONL meter path (default `~/.repo-manager/mutation-meter.jsonl`) |
|
||||
| `REPO_MANAGER_SRC` | Optional path to `repo-manager/src` for SH adapter |
|
||||
| `RMGR_BIN` | Optional override command prefix for `rmgr` |
|
||||
|
||||
## Rollback
|
||||
|
||||
```bash
|
||||
unset RM_WRITEBACK RM_RECONCILE RM_PILOT_REPOS
|
||||
# or
|
||||
export RM_WRITEBACK=0 RM_RECONCILE=0
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
State Hub immediately uses native C-15 writeback again.

"""Dual-run flags and checkout-mutation meter (RMGR-WP-0002 / ArchitectureBlueprint Stage B).
|
||||
|
||||
Environment variables (shared with State Hub adapter):
|
||||
|
||||
RM_WRITEBACK=1|true|yes — file+git task writeback via repo-manager
|
||||
RM_RECONCILE=1|true|yes — reconcile path prefers repo-manager for pilot repos
|
||||
RM_PILOT_REPOS=slug1,slug2 — if set, flags only apply to these slugs; empty = all
|
||||
RM_METER_PATH=~/.repo-manager/mutation-meter.jsonl — append-only meter log
|
||||
|
||||
Rollback: unset flags or set to 0 → State Hub native path only.
|
||||
"""
